What Is The Point Of Having A Server At Home?

What Is The Point Of Having A Server At Home?
What Is The Point Of Having A Server At Home?. What,Point,Having,Server,Home

What's the Point of Having a Server at Home?

Introduction

In the digital age, having a home server has become increasingly popular. But what exactly is a server, and what are its benefits? This comprehensive guide will answer all your questions about home servers, from their purpose to their setup and maintenance.

What is a Server?

A server is a computer that provides services to other computers on a network. It can store files, host websites, run applications, and much more. Unlike a personal computer, which is designed for a single user, a server is designed to handle multiple users simultaneously.

Types of Servers

There are several types of servers, each with its purpose. Some common types include:

  • File servers store and manage files for multiple users on a network.
  • Web servers host websites and deliver web pages to users.
  • Application servers run software applications and provide services to other applications.
  • Database servers store and manage databases, which are collections of data.

Benefits of Having a Home Server

Having a home server offers several advantages:

  • Centralized storage: Store all your files in one central location, making them accessible to all authorized users on your network.
  • Data backup: Create backups of your important data to protect against loss or corruption.
  • Website hosting: Host your own website without relying on third-party services.
  • Run applications: Use the server to run specific applications, such as media streaming, gaming, or home automation.
  • Cost-effective: Compared to renting a dedicated server, owning a home server can be a more cost-effective option.

Choosing a Home Server

When choosing a home server, consider the following factors:

  • Operating system: There are several operating systems available for home servers, such as Windows, Linux, and FreeNAS.
  • Hardware: Determine the hardware requirements based on the intended use of the server.
  • Storage capacity: Choose a server with sufficient storage capacity to meet your needs.
  • Networking: Ensure the server has the necessary networking capabilities to connect to your devices.

Setting Up a Home Server

Setting up a home server involves several steps:

Choosing Hardware

Select the hardware components for your server, including the motherboard, CPU, memory, storage, and networking card.

Installing the Operating System

Install the chosen operating system onto the server. This process may vary depending on the OS.

Configuring the Network

Configure the network settings to connect the server to your network.

Installing Applications

Install the necessary software applications to provide the desired services, such as a file server, web server, or backup solution.

Maintaining a Home Server

Maintaining a home server requires regular attention:

Software Updates

Install software updates to patch security vulnerabilities and enhance functionality.

Hardware Maintenance

Clean the server periodically to prevent overheating and other issues. Check for any faulty components and replace them if necessary.

Monitoring

Monitor the server's performance and usage to ensure it's running smoothly. Use tools like Nagios or Zabbix for remote monitoring.

Conclusion

Having a home server can be beneficial for centralized storage, data backup, website hosting, and running various applications. By choosing the right hardware, setting it up correctly, and maintaining it regularly, you can enjoy the advantages of a home server while ensuring its optimal performance.

FAQs

  1. What are the advantages of a home server?
  • Centralized storage, data backup, website hosting, cost-effectiveness.
  1. What factors should I consider when choosing a home server?
  • Operating system, hardware requirements, storage capacity, networking capabilities.
  1. What are the steps involved in setting up a home server?
  • Choosing hardware, installing OS, configuring network, installing applications.
  1. How do I maintain a home server?
  • Install software updates, perform hardware maintenance, monitor performance.
  1. What are some common operating systems for home servers?
  • Windows, Linux, FreeNAS.
  1. Can I store personal files on a home server?
  • Yes, a home server can be used as a centralized file storage for authorized users.
  1. Is it necessary to back up data stored on a home server?
  • Yes, regular backups are essential to protect against data loss or corruption.
  1. Can I host my own website on a home server?
  • Yes, a home server with a web server application can be used to host websites.
  1. How do I access files stored on my home server?
  • Access files through network shares, FTP, or web-based storage services.
  1. What are the costs involved in setting up a home server?
  • The costs vary depending on the hardware, operating system, and storage requirements.

SEO-Keywords

  • Home Server
  • Server Benefits
  • Home Server Setup
  • Server Maintenance
  • File Storage
  • Data Backup
  • Website Hosting
  • Application Server
  • Operating System
  • Hardware